【环境搭建】Jupyter Notebook的安装与配置

写在前面的两点建议:1. 在开始动手实现教程之前,应当先更换你的pip镜像源:win10更换镜像源、ubuntu18.04更换镜像源。2. 建议先通过anaconda安装好python!!!这样可以大量节省花在安装上的时间。

一、Jupyter-notebook的安装

先展示效果图:

jupyter notebook最终界面展示一
jupyter notebook最终界面展示二

1.1 通过anaconda安装Jupyter-notebook(推荐)

1.1.1 win10下安装与启动

若用anaconda安装过python全家桶,应该已经自带jupyter notebook,可从cmd命令框启动或直接点击图标启动,默认路径为C:\Users\“你的用户名”,如代码文件路径需要保存在其他地方,可参考链接:修改Anaconda中的Jupyter Notebook默认工作路径,右键jupyter notebook的图标打开属性界面,具体方式如下图所示:

修改Anaconda中的Jupyter Notebook默认工作路径

1.1.2 ubuntu18.04环境下安装与启动

如果是在ubuntu下使用anaconda安装了python,直接在终端中输入jupyter-notebook即可打开。

1.2 通过pip安装(不推荐)

终端下运行:

pip install jupyter-notebook
#如果之前使用了anaconda安装python,可忽略该行命令

二、Jupyter-notebook的配置

2.1 换主题

换主题参考链接:https://github.com/dunovank/jupyter-themes
终端下运行如下代码:

pip install jupyterthemes    # install jupyterthemes
pip install --upgrade jupyterthemes    # upgrade to latest version

我的设置如下:

jt -t monokai -fs 165 -tfs 11 -nfs 115 -ofs 135 -cellw 80% -T -N
# monokai为暗系皮肤
# jt -t 主题名,更换主题
# -fs 字号
# -nfs notebook的字号
# -ofs 输出字号
# -cellw 占屏宽
# -T 显示工具栏 -N显示当前文件名

主题效果图见文首,也可以根据帮助指令自行设置主题,查看指令帮助:
但是!!!我觉得上面那个挺好看的,建议照敲,然后直接跳到2.2节~

jt -h

运行后指令说明如下图,可据此自行选择风格:

指令说明

查看可用主题(注意是小写的L):

jt -l

输出结果:

Available Themes: 
   chesterish
   grade3
   gruvboxd
   gruvboxl
   monokai
   oceans16
   onedork
   solarizedd
   solarizedl

2.2 插件安装代码补齐

安装 nbextensions 与 nbextensions_configurator,在终端运行如下代码:

pip install jupyter_contrib_nbextensions
jupyter contrib nbextension install --user
pip install jupyter_nbextensions_configurator
jupyter nbextensions_configurator enable --user

重启jupyter,在弹出的主页面里,能看到增加了一个Nbextensions标签页,先点一下Configurable nbextensions下面那个“√”,就可以这个页面里选择要安装的插件——勾选Hinterland即启用了代码自动补全。勾选完需要的插件后,再把Configurable nbextensions下面那个“√”点一下就ok了。

切换到Nbextensions标签页
第二次点完“√”后的界面
粗线了代码补全功能

Jupyter Notebook的安装与配置就写到这里,如果有问题的话欢迎留言私信交流,后面我会经常利用Jupyter Notebook跑一些python代码~

你可能感兴趣的:(【环境搭建】Jupyter Notebook的安装与配置)